AGH Solutions is seeking a Head of Corporate Governance to lead and oversee all aspects of corporate governance, company secretarial services and statutory compliance across the organisation. Reporting directly to the Managing Director, this is a key leadership position responsible for ensuring the organisation operates in line with all legal, regulatory and governance requirements while supporting the Board and senior leadership team in delivering effective decision-making and governance practices.
The Head of Corporate Governance will act as the principal governance advisor to the Board, ensuring the highest standards of corporate governance are maintained across the business.
Duties:
- Acting as Secretary to the Board and Committees, coordinating agendas, board packs, minutes and actions
- Advising the Board and senior leadership team on governance, statutory and regulatory matters
- Managing the organisation's governance framework and annual governance calendar
- Ensuring compliance with Companies Act requirements, statutory records and Companies House filings
- Leading the development, implementation and review of governance policies and procedures
- Supporting Board effectiveness reviews, succession planning and director inductions
- Maintaining key governance documentation including Articles of Association, Schemes of Delegation and Terms of Reference
- Managing governance reporting to shareholders and external bodies
- Leading governance training and development for Board members and senior stakeholders
- Undertaking horizon scanning to identify governance and regulatory developments
- Managing company risk governance, including oversight of the Board Assurance Framework
- Providing leadership to corporate governance, quality and communications functions
